Don Gollito Restaurant has been around since July 2019, serving some of best homemade corn or flour tortillas, breakfast tacos, menudo, barbacoa, carne guisada, enchiladas Mexicanas, gorditas, brisket, BBQ chicken, dino ribs, Taco Grande (just like El Taquito Restaurant) and so many other delicious & delightful Mexican dishes in the city of Harlingen, Texas.
